对于初学者,我已经检查了大多数可用的解决方案,否
如何用shell脚本解压缩所有.tar.gz?
解压缩目录中的多个zip文件?
我有一个目录,其中包含带有.gz文件的子目录,并且希望将其全部提取到一个文件夹中,或者仅将它们保留在其文件夹中。先感谢你
如果我理解你的问题,你可以使用类似
DEST=<Destination Folder> SRC=<Src Folder> find $SRC -name "*.tar.gz" -or -name "*.tgz" -exec tar xzvvf -C $DEST {} \;
tar xvzf怎么做?
find . -name "*.bz2" | while read filename; do tar -xvzf -C "
目录名“ $ filename”" "$filename"; done;
不起作用将
z
(用于gzip的)更改为j
(用于bzip2的)tar -xvjf